Trump Family Background, Scottish Roots, Housing Discrimination Lawsuit

Donald Trump attributes his flair for the dramatic to his Scottish-born mother, Mary Anne Trump, while describing his father as a "meat and potatoes" provider. He addresses a past federal lawsuit regarding alleged racial discrimination in his father's housing projects. Trump maintains that they never discriminated based on race but refused to rent to welfare recipients to preserve building quality, eventually settling the case without admitting guilt.
